带裂缝钢筋混凝土结构的有限元分析 被引量:4

Considering Crack Propagation of Mechanical Finite Element Analysis of Reinforced Concrete Structures

摘要 在影响工程结构质量的众多因素中,裂缝所导致的质量问题最为严重。因其具有演变形随着时间的迁移,部分裂缝的宽度和高度也会发生相应的变化,裂缝的等级也会随之提高。给工程整体质量增添了诸多不安全因素。进一步提升工程质量,控制好工程裂缝问题,在进行钢筋混凝土结构有限元模拟时应当积极的考虑到裂缝现象。文章首先从混凝土结构入手,构建钢筋混凝土有限元模型,进而开展混凝土结构有限元分析,希望为建筑工程钢筋混凝土施工提供一些有益的建议,以供参考。 There are many factors influence the quality of engineering structures in the cracks caused by quality problems are most serious.Because it has played deformation over time,crack width and height will change accordingly,crack level will be increased.Adding many unsafe factors to the quality of the whole project.To further enhance the quality of the project,to control the engineering crack problem,should be actively considering the cracks in reinforced concrete structure finite element simulation.Firstly,from the concrete structure,constructing the finite element model of reinforced concrete,and then carry out the finite element analysis of concrete structures,hope for the construction of reinforced concrete Soil construction to provide some useful suggestions for reference.
